SAS 16 RATIONALE
1. Answer: D
Self-instruction method provides or design activities that guide the learner in
independently achieving the educational objectives; formats include workbooks, study
guides, work station, videotapes, internet modules, and computer program.
2. Answer: A
Simulation it is a trial-and-error method of teaching that an artificial experience is created
that engages the learner in an activity that reflects real-life conditions but without the
risk-taking consequences of an actual situation, it teaches critical thinking, high level
decision making.
3. Answer: B
Role play is an instructional method where learners actively participate in an unrehearsed
dramatization.
4. Answer: C
Role modeling is a learning called identification and emanates from learning and
developmental theories.
5. Answer: D
Gaming is an instructional method requiring the learner to participate in a competitive
activity with preset rules. It may be purchased or self-developed.
